Self Confidence


Alright ladies. This post is for you. I just went to party where you got your tummy wrapped. Why? Well, I told the host I thought I could make it, it sounded silly, and yes, sadly this is my "problem area." About ten women got wrapped and sat around talking about how fat they were and how time was stealing their good looks. A couple women even said that they wouldn't tell their 8-10 year old daughters what kind of party they were going to because they didn't want their little girls to think about weight and self-esteem issues yet.

Let me remind you, YOU were once a little girl. You were a little girl who used to twirl to music and thought you were beautiful and thought that that freckle on your big toe was the cutest thing ever. You believed your dad or mom when they said, "You're special. You're extraordinary. You're beautiful." You believed them even when you had a poodle perm, braces and the beginning of acne. And now look at you. You have birthed, nursed, and loved your very own children and you no longer can see your beauty.

Move closer to your computer screen. I'm going into mommy mode a minute. I am putting my hands up and holding your face in my hands and I am saying, "You are beautiful and special and SO worthy of love." And please, guard your ears and eyes from whomever or whatever that says you are not. Guard YOURSELF just like you guard your own children.
